6. What business opportunities?

As in the case of other software, there are many different ways of acquiring a license for industrial use of simulation software.

The widespread deployment of Internet technologies, on the one hand, and advances in computer workstation architecture (client-server technologies, increased local computing power as opposed to that of large-scale computing centers, networks of distributed machines, etc.), on the other hand, are bringing new distribution methods to the fore, or bringing them back into fashion.

The very different time constants between the development of finite element simulation software (several decades) and the deployment of a technological level of computer techniques (a few years), lead to major disparities between marketing and distribution methods.
